Comparison of minilaparoscopy and single-incision intragastric surgery for gastric submucosal tumor resection in a porcine model.

Abstract

BACKGROUND

The aim of this study was to develop an easy-to-induce and reproducible model of gastric submucosal tumor in swine to compare minilaparoscopy (ML) with single-incision (SI) intragastric surgery.

METHODS

Twelve healthy female pigs (weight 30.94 ± 2.49 kg) underwent a transparietal injection of sterile alginate at the level of Z-line (n = 6) and at the pre-pyloric area (n = 6) creating a model of gastric submucosal pseudotumor. The operative procedures included intragastric resection with ML and SI approaches of cardiac and pre-pyloric lesions, with gastroscopic assistance. After resection, the gastric mucosal layer was closed using intracorporeal sutures. The operative time, complication rate and clinical evolution after 1 month were compared in the four groups that the pigs were arranged.

RESULTS

The pseudotumors ranged in size from 3 to 6 cm in diameter. The access of the gastric cavity and resection of the experimental SMP and suturing of the mucosa were performed successfully in 12 animals using both approaches. Mean time to perform the exeresis of gastric cardia tumors was significantly higher in single-incision approach. No significant differences were observed in the surgical time during pyloric surgery. Minilaparoscopic approach reduced significantly the mucosa closure time in esophagogastric and pyloric pseudotumors. One month after, no alterations were shown in the abdominal cavity using exploratory laparotomy.

CONCLUSIONS

The technical feasibility of performing safe and efficient intragastric approach of submucosal pseudotumors in swine model was verified in this study. Intragastric ML has advantages over SI, namely regarding the reduction in total surgical times and the fewer technical difficulties.

摘要

背景

本研究的目的是建立一种易于诱导且可重复的猪胃黏膜下肿瘤模型,以比较微型腹腔镜(ML)与单切口(SI)胃内手术。

方法

12只健康雌性猪(体重30.94±2.49千克)在Z线水平(n = 6)和幽门前区域(n = 6)接受经壁注射无菌藻酸盐,建立胃黏膜下假瘤模型。手术操作包括在胃镜辅助下,采用ML和SI方法对贲门和幽门前病变进行胃内切除。切除后,使用体内缝合线关闭胃黏膜层。比较将猪分组后的四组手术时间、并发症发生率和1个月后的临床进展。

结果

假瘤直径范围为3至6厘米。两种方法均成功对12只动物进行了胃腔进入、实验性胃黏膜下肿物切除及黏膜缝合。单切口入路切除贲门部胃肿瘤的平均时间明显更长。幽门手术的手术时间无显著差异。微型腹腔镜入路显著缩短了食管胃和幽门假瘤的黏膜关闭时间。1个月后,剖腹探查显示腹腔无异常。

结论

本研究验证了在猪模型中安全有效地进行胃黏膜下假瘤胃内入路手术的技术可行性。胃内ML相比SI具有优势,即在缩短总手术时间和减少技术难度方面。
